With all in game volume sliders completely to the left (off), the "Mission Successful" audio clip (that is played upon winning a skirmish) is played at your system volume setting.

Steps to Reproduce:
• Slide all warzone volume sliders to the left.
• Keep your global system volume at a point where you can hear it.
• Defeat all rival teams in a skirmish
• Before the game summary screen, you'll hear the usual WZ voice at your system volume say "Mission Successful," despite all volume sliders at zero.
